2001 Disco 2 td5 Right hand drive.
Going to tackle this tomorrow and have bought a 5L bottle of Dot 4 from halfords.
This is what I am going to attempt and will take pictures to post up here as a guide.
Due to the height of the disco there is no need to jack up the wheels. Suck out old brake fluid from resovoir to minimum level. Then top up to max level with new brake fluid.
Attach clear drain hose to front left bleed nipple and put into jar with the hose submerged with new fluid.
Get friend to pump the brakes up until they will pump no more and hold the pressure. Unscrew brake nipple and wait till new fluid can be seen flowing out of bleed nipple.
repeat in this order *have seen so many variations of this. Mine is a 2001 td5 right hand drive and according to the rave manual this is the procedure for bleeding the system.
1. Front left passenger wheel
2. Front right drivers wheel
3. Rear left passenger wheel
4. rear right passenger wheel.
After i have bled the four wheels i will attach the clear hose to the clutch slave cylinder under the bonnet and again put it into a jar submerged in new fluid.
Get buddy to fully depress the clutch and release with bleed screw loosened. Repeat a few times until clear fluid flows out of hose into jar.
Get buddy to fully depress clutch and hold, then tighten the bleed screw.
Is this the correct method to change the brake and clutch system fluids???
